Cardano生態系統引入燃燒證明協議 構建創新解決方案

robot
摘要生成中

燃燒證明協議:Cardano生態系統的創新解決方案

近期,針對Charles Hoskinson提出的挑戰,Iagon團隊開發了一種適用於Cardano生態系統的燃燒證明(PoB)協議。本文將介紹這一創新解決方案的主要內容:

燃燒證明機制概述

燃燒證明本質上是將代幣發送到一個無法訪問的"黑洞"地址,實現代幣的永久銷毀。這種機制有多重用途,既可以增加剩餘代幣的價值,也可以作爲區塊鏈協議的承諾證明。

燃燒證明的安全性基於加密哈希函數。通過翻轉哈希函數輸出的最低位,可以創建一個難以恢復的黑洞地址。這種方法不僅保證了交易的安全性,還能防止燃燒行爲被立即識別。

Cardano網路上的燃燒證明智能合約

Cardano智能合約包含三個主要組成部分:

  1. 贖回者腳本:控制eUTxOs的花費
  2. 錢包腳本:代表用戶執行資金贖回和創建新的eUTxOs
  3. eUTxOs:持有資金和用於贖回的數據點

基於這一結構,燃燒證明協議可以實現四種操作:燃燒、驗證燃燒、鎖定和贖回。值得注意的是,這些操作在用戶錢包中完成,隨後才提交到區塊鏈上。

智能合約部署流程

在測試網上部署該智能合約需要以下步驟:

  1. 安裝Haskell工具鏈
  2. 構建Plutus腳本
  3. 啓動Cardano節點和錢包容器
  4. 恢復錢包並獲取錢包ID
  5. 執行代幣燃燒
  6. 驗證燃燒操作

從智能合約到錢包腳本

爲了進一步提高安全性並防止審查,可以將大部分操作轉移到用戶錢包中進行。這種方法使得審查燃燒交易變得極其困難,除非審查所有Cardano交易。

實現這一目標需要使用承諾值的哈希替代公鑰哈希,並翻轉承諾值的最低位。同時,還需要考慮Cardano的地址格式要求,使用特定腳本和Cardano API庫生成燃燒地址。

結語

燃燒證明協議爲Cardano生態系統帶來了新的可能性。盡管目前Alonzo智能合約平台尚未完全具備所需的基礎設施,但隨着PAB庫的實施,結合錢包腳本的復雜智能合約解決方案將成爲可能,爲創建抗審查環境奠定基礎。

ADA4.16%
查看原文
此頁面可能包含第三方內容,僅供參考(非陳述或保證),不應被視為 Gate 認可其觀點表述,也不得被視為財務或專業建議。詳見聲明
  • 讚賞
  • 5
  • 分享
留言
0/400
Token经济学人vip
· 14小時前
实际上,这种销毁机制只是经济学101的供给冲击理论。
查看原文回復0
Vibes Over Chartsvip
· 23小時前
稳了!项目终于开始明白通缩咋玩了
回復0
TooScaredToSellvip
· 23小時前
ada要来了 敢买吗
回復0
鲸落见证者vip
· 23小時前
学好英语会说话了?
回復0
LayerZeroEnjoyervip
· 07-20 22:41
ada终于玩烧币了?
回復0
交易,隨時隨地
qrCode
掃碼下載 Gate APP
社群列表
繁體中文
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)